Hi team,

This covers the Purgewell data-retention sweeper for anyone on call this cycle. The sweeper runs hourly, deleting records past their retention window in the Ferngate archive. If a run exceeds 20 minutes or the deletion count spikes above baseline, it halts and pages on-call. Before resuming a halted run, verify the retention policy table hasn't changed mid-sweep — a policy edit during execution is the most common cause. To query the sweeper's admin endpoint and resume safely, authenticate with the token below.

session JWT of yawep-yawep = eyJhbGciOiJIUzI1NiIsInR5cCI6IkpXVCJ9.eyJzdWIiOiI3pWF3_In0.aXYsHiog

### Step 4 — Configure the receipt mailer

Before cutting the release, make sure Givnote's mailer env file points at the production relay, not the rehearsal one — donors get cranky about duplicate receipts. Double-check `MAILER_RELAY_HOST` and the from-address vars, then add the relay credential. It gets rotated each quarter, and the current one belongs on the line right after this sentence.

env line for fafof-fahag: LEDGER_TOKEN5=f8790

**Fan-out Backpressure (Brindlehook Notify)**

When a notification fan-out exceeds the per-plugin delivery budget, Brindlehook Notify applies backpressure by returning a 429 with a `X-Drain-After` header rather than dropping events. Plugin authors should pause enqueueing until the drain window elapses, then resume at half the prior rate. To inspect your current budget and queue depth, call the internal quota service, authenticating with the key below:

app token of hawif-yaguf = kto15_D1YHEykrtxKxx7V

Briefing — Leadership Review: Stellaro Rewards Overhaul

Quick context for the board: our loyalty programme, Stellaro Rewards, is showing its age — redemption rates have slid three quarters running and members tell us the tiers feel stingy. The overhaul swaps points-per-purchase for a spend-velocity model and adds partner perks through Hollin & Grave retail. Cost to rebuild is modest; the real bet is retention lift in the Ardmore market. Full financials are in the deck. The confidential plan summary sits just below this line.

internal memo for yahag-tahog: The pricing group signed off on a budget of $152.8 million for Project Soriel.